Our client, a leading professional services legal firm, has a unique opportunity to hire an in-house Talent Acquisition Specialist for a 12-month fixed-term contract. The role will join a busy recruitment team. You will recruit across multiple practice areas and will be an ambassador and first point of contact for lateral recruitment for the firm. This is an excellent brand, with an excellent reputation. They are employers of choice and you will also work as part of a wider HR team.

Excellent base salary on offer and benefits to include; Healthcare, Hybrid working, Bonus, Gym, Subsidised Canteen and much more.

About the Role:

  • Manage the full life cycle of a varied portfolio of roles;
  • Advertising roles internally and externally, sourcing direct candidates, and building a talent pipeline;
  • Develop strong relationships with PSL;
  • Manage the interview process, providing expert consultative advice to internal clients;
  • Conduct screening calls with applicants and interviews with hiring managers;
  • Prepare and manage offer documentation;
  • Prepare and send contracts and new starter documents to joiners, regarding onboarding;
  • Manage the business services graduate and act as a mentor;
  • Work closely with the Recruitment Senior Manager on day-to-day operational issues and the delivery of strategic projects.

The Candidate

  • You have at least three years' experience in recruitment, ideally in a corporate environment or a professional services agency;
  • Excellent management of key stakeholder relationships and external agency management;
  • Ability to work under pressure whilst remaining professional at all times;
  • Have a clear understanding of the recruitment process ensuring an excellent recruitment experience for both the hiring manager and candidate.
